Simple Mechanical Keyboard Projects for Tech Enthusiasts

Keyboard Assembly Kits For an entry-level tech enthusiast, keyboard assembly kits are an excellent project. Basic kits come with a switch, a case, and a PCB (Printed Circuit Board). The assembly involves straightforward soldering, which

Written by: Gabriel Rocha

Published on: May 5, 2026

  1. Keyboard Assembly Kits

For an entry-level tech enthusiast, keyboard assembly kits are an excellent project. Basic kits come with a switch, a case, and a PCB (Printed Circuit Board). The assembly involves straightforward soldering, which is not only a useful skill in electronics but also an engaging process.

To begin, follow the straightforward steps. First, you assemble the stabilizers which prevent larger keys from wobbling when pressed. Next, you secure the PCB and then proceed to solder in the switches. Post this, you’d want to add keycaps of your choice to customize it further.

Some assembly kits don’t require soldering and come fully soldered. They include hot-swappable PCBs which let you switch out the mechanical switches anytime you want.

Recommended assembly kits for beginners include the ‘Anne Pro 2’, ‘Ducky One 2 Mini’, and the ‘GK61’ which are fully programmable and compatible with all MX style keyboard switches.

  1. Custom Keycap Designing

There’s nothing more gratifying than possessing a customized set of keycaps. Keyboard enthusiasts often spend time choosing, designing, and sometimes even crafting their own keycaps. To set their keyboards apart, they employ various methods such as hand painting, laser engraving, and dye-sublimation.

Although a time-consuming process, hand painting keycaps has its unique charm. It requires special acrylic paint to meticulously paint the design onto the caps.

Laser engraving, on the other hand, involves the use of a machine to engrave designs onto the keycaps. It is a more advanced method but produces magnificent results.

Dye-sublimation is a popular method among tech enthusiasts. It involves heating the ink to convert it into a gas which then permeates the keycap, therefore creating a design that doesn’t fade.

  1. DIY Mechanical Keyboard Case

For experienced tech enthusiasts, creating a DIY mechanical keyboard case can be a fun and rewarding project.

Wooden keyboard cases are a popular choice due to their solid construction, natural feel, and aesthetic value. You can use woods like mahogany, cherry, or oak for a classy finish.

Start by measuring your keyboard’s dimensions. Then, cut the wood according to these measurements and shape it into a case for your keyboard. Afterward, sand the wooden case smoothly and apply a clear coat of varnish for protection.

For a more innovative and unique approach, you can consider 3D printing a custom case. The first step is to design the case using CAD software. After designing, simply print the parts on a 3D printer, assemble them, and you have a DIY mechanical keyboard case.

  1. Handwiring a Mechanical Keyboard

Handwiring a mechanical keyboard is a challenging project for tech enthusiasts who want to build a custom keyboard from scratch. This project involves creating your own circuits instead of using a PCB.

Start by selecting a keyboard layout that you want to create. The next step is to place your switches on a plate that matches your desired layout. Each switch’s terminal should be connected to a diode – this is a must for any keyboard to function correctly.

The next step is to wire each row and column. The rows should be wired together and the columns should be wired together, but make sure the two do not cross. The ends of the rows and columns are then connected to a microcontroller like a Teensy or Pro Micro.

Apart from deepening your understanding of how keyboards work, handwiring a keyboard also provides a level of flexibility that pre-made PCBs can’t offer.

  1. Programming a Keyboard

Programming a keyboard is an exciting project that can make your work or gaming experience more efficient. You can reprogram your keys to match your usage habits or create shortcuts for frequently used commands.

QMK is a popular free software that you can use to program your keyboard. It provides tools to create and compile custom keyboard layouts.

You start by plugging your keyboard into your computer and opening the software. Then, you choose a keyboard layout to modify or create a new one from scratch. Assign actions to each key according to your preferences and compile the layout. Finally, flash the firmware onto your keyboard using QMK’s toolbox.

To wrap up, it’s clear that mechanical keyboard projects offer a fascinating blend of DIY electronics, craftsmanship, and computer programming. They demand patience, precision, and hands-on skill but the end results are worth the effort. The journey to personalize the very tool you interact with daily can truly be a rewarding experience. You can always start small with keyboard kit assembly or custom keycap designs and gradually move on to larger projects like hand wiring or programming keyboards.

Leave a Comment

Previous

Best Tools for Mechanical Keyboard Customization.

Next

Beginner Guide to DIY Home Decor Crafts